MKC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2017 in Review

658 of the 4,011 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in McCormick & Company Non-Voting (MKC) for Q2 2017, worth a combined $8.97B — down 0.84% from $9.04B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 49 funds opened new MKC positions and 34 closed out — a net gain of 15 holders — while 204 added to existing stakes and 264 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Vanguard Group, adding an estimated $30.5M. The largest seller was BlackRock, cutting an estimated $47M.
